In 1989 Nigel Baker<br />
started Calico Cottage in the UK, initially<br />
importing mixes and fudgemaking machines (known as a kettle) from its namesake in the USA but very quickly moving<br />
into manufacturing.<br />
Whilst links to our American colleagues remain very strong, 26 years on Calico is an established British manufacturing<br />
success story with year on year growth right through the recent recession. Every fudge kettle and every bag of fudge mix<br />
is made in our factory in Cambridgeshire and the company is still 100% owned by the Baker family. Three generations of<br />
the family work in the company to this day.<br />
Twenty five years prior to Calico starting in Europe, an American gentleman by the name of Leonard Wurzel had a chain<br />
of candy making stores within supermarkets in the USA. The supermarkets closed down leaving Leonard with leases to<br />
pay but no customers. His business was nearly crushed under the pressure of hundreds of thousands of dollars of debt.<br />
Rather than default on these debts, he started Calico Cottage, a company which has now grown to be the World's Largest<br />
Provider of fudgemaking ingredients and equipment. Leonard paid every dollar back and his company is now run by his<br />
sons from a state of the art facility on Long Island New York.<br />
Calico in the USA helped us get started in Europe and gave us great support at a time when UK banks would not. We still<br />
have close ties to Calico Cottage in America and swap knowledge and experiences on a daily basis. Whilst their flavours<br />
may seem a bit odd at times (they would say the same about ours!), our American Partners' ethics and principles are<br />
untouchable and we work to the same high standards here in Europe.<br />

The fudge which you make with our programme sells for<br />
between £2.25/100g and £3.00/100g. It costs around<br />
50p/100g to make.<br />
If you are not VAT registered it’s worth noting that there’s<br />
no VAT on the mix and so 50p/100g is all you pay.<br />
With suitable promotions, you should achieve an average<br />
sale of close to £6.
WILL<br />
<strong>FUDGEMAKING</strong><br />
WORK FOR ME?<br />
The only real way to tell this is to talk over your plans<br />
with us. We will give you straight advice because the<br />
last thing we want to do is sell a kettle and never sell<br />
another case of mix to you. However, there are<br />
certain characteristics which successful fudge retailers<br />
all have in common:<br />
GREAT LOCATION – Good passing trade with the<br />
fudge display adjacent to the cash register.<br />
GREAT DISPLAY - People buy with their eyes. If your<br />
display is not attractive you will kill your profits dead.<br />
FRIENDLY SALES STAFF – Success comes from visitors<br />
enjoying their experience. Handing out small samples<br />
with a smile and a welcome will pay dividends.<br />
UPSELLING -You have an amazing display with fudge<br />
that simply cannot be bought anywhere else so make<br />
sure people are encouraged to buy more than one<br />
flavour!<br />

From four base mixes you can make 400 varieties of<br />
fudge. From start to finish it will take three hours to<br />
make 30kg of fudge in up to 12 different flavours<br />
with a retail value of £600. For much of those three<br />
hours you can go away and do something else whilst<br />
the fudge is left mixing. Does it still sound like hard<br />
work?!<br />

THE START-UP KIT<br />
We sell a start-up kit that enables you to make<br />
150kg of fudge with a retail value of about £3200<br />
plus VAT.<br />
The kettle costs us £3400 to make and we deliver<br />
it to you for £3500 plus VAT. With utensils,<br />
flavourings, start up packaging and fudge mix you<br />
will spend £4600 plus VAT. We also train you onsite<br />
for two days at our cost. The contents of the start<br />
up kit can be changed to suit your requirements.<br />
Needless to say, if you’re not selling fudge mix,<br />
we’re not making money. We both have a mutual<br />
interest in getting you the highest possible return<br />
on your investment.<br />
Equally, we will tell you<br />
upfront if we do not believe fudgemaking will<br />
work for you.<br />
At twenty sales per day it will take<br />
less than 90 days to recover your<br />
investment. We’ve even had people<br />
recover it in just three days.<br />
Fudge sells at typically £2.50/100g and<br />
costs you around 50p/100g to make<br />
including butter, flavourings and<br />
delivery charges of about 2.5p/100g.<br />
At a retail price of £2.50/100g you will<br />
make £1.58/100g profit after VAT*.<br />
Adding additional ingredients such as<br />
nuts, dried fruit, marshmallows,<br />
meringue pieces and toffee pieces<br />
will change this price but not<br />
dramatically.<br />
*based on 2016 price data<br />

WHAT HAPPENS NEXT?<br />
As soon as you’re ready to go with a great display in<br />
the right location, Calico’s efforts focus on getting you<br />
set up and trained correctly. We spend two days with<br />
you and your team; the first is spent making fudge<br />
and the second is spent retailing it. The first day is the<br />
easier day but the second is critical and has to be done<br />
with some live customers in your shop. Retraining is<br />
also available for those of you with a high turnover<br />
of staff. Once you are up and running, you can receive<br />
continued support from Calico with seasonal ideas<br />
and promotions so that your display never starts to<br />
look tired. There’s a flavour for every time of the year<br />
whether it’s colourful fruity flavours in the summer or<br />
suitably festive flavours and decoration in the later<br />
months. You’ll be amazed at the difference it makes.<br />
Never forget that fudge is an impulse purchase so the<br />
better it looks, the more tempting it becomes and the<br />
more likely people are to come back! This could help<br />
increase sales of your other lines and certainly<br />
increases average spend per head so make sure that<br />
your display is always looking fabulous!<br />
